Somatic cells undergo Mitosis. The nucleus and all its contents have to be replicated (copied) and divided into the daughter cells. The process where the nucleus divides is called karyokinesis

The process described is cell division, specifically the splitting of the nucleus known as mitosis. During mitosis, the cell's genetic material is equally distributed into two daughter nuclei, ensuring each new cell receives a complete set of chromosomes.
mitosis starts with one diploid(2n) and then goes to two diploids(2n) In a human there is 46 chromosomes (23 homologous pair)
